1999 Miami Dolphins Season

The 1999 Miami Dolphins season was the team's 34th campaign, and 30th in the National Football League. It was the final season for Dolphins quarterback Dan Marino. Although they made the second wild card spot with a 9–7 record, and managed to upset the Seattle Seahawks in the Wild Card round of the playoffs, they were humiliated by the Jacksonville Jaguars 62-7 in the Divisional round, the most lopsided playoff game of the Super Bowl era.
